Acheta is a genus of crickets. It most notably contains the house cricket (Acheta domesticus). According to Direction 46 issued by the ICZN in 1956, this generic name is masculine in gender.[3] Apart from the cosmoplitan house cricket, species are recorded from the Palaearctic realm and North America.[2]
